首页 > 数据库 > mysql教程 > 我可以在不使用 mysqldump 的情况下克隆 MySQL 数据库吗?

我可以在不使用 mysqldump 的情况下克隆 MySQL 数据库吗?

Mary-Kate Olsen
发布: 2024-11-29 13:10:11
原创
330 人浏览过

Can I Clone a MySQL Database Without Using mysqldump?

不使用 mysqldump 克隆 MySQL 数据库

对于寻求 mysqldump 替代方案来复制 MySQL 数据库的用户,这里有一个可行的方法:

问题:是否可以复制 MySQL 数据库(使用或没有内容)到另一个而不使用mysqldump?

解决方案:

虽然最初的问题排除了mysqldump,但使用命令行的有效解决方案是:

  1. 使用 MySQLAdmin 或首选方法创建目标数据库。例如,我们创建一个名为“db2”的目标数据库。
  2. 在命令行中执行以下命令:
mysqldump -h [server] -u [user] -p[password] db1 | mysql -h [server] -u [user] -p[password] db2
登录后复制

记住省略“-p”之间的空格和密码。

使用此方法,您可以从服务器无缝复制 MySQL 数据库,即使没有直接本地访问。

以上是我可以在不使用 mysqldump 的情况下克隆 MySQL 数据库吗?的详细内容。更多信息请关注PHP中文网其他相关文章!

来源:php.cn
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
作者最新文章
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板